New drug combo tested to fight advanced throat cancer

NCT ID NCT03734809

Summary

This study is testing a new, year-long treatment plan for people with advanced nasopharyngeal cancer (a type of throat cancer). The plan combines an immunotherapy drug (pembrolizumab) with chemotherapy and radiation. The main goal is to see if this approach is safe and can better control the cancer and prevent it from spreading to other parts of the body.
